Flappy Goku is a free online arcade game that blends the addictive mechanics of Flappy Bird with beloved characters from the Dragon Ball Z universe. Players control Goku as he flies through a series of narrow gaps between walls. Each successful pass earns a point, and the game ends if you touch a wall or the ground. The latest version 1.1 adds Krillin and Arale Norimaki as playable characters, giving fans more variety. To play Flappy Goku, tap or click the screen to make your character fly upward. Release to let them descend. Your goal is to navigate through the gaps between the walls without hitting them or the ground. Each gap you pass gives you one point. The game speed increases as you progress, and the gaps become smaller. If you crash, the game ends and you can restart immediately. There is no end point; the challenge is to keep going and beat your personal best score. Practice helps improve your timing and control.

To improve your score, focus on maintaining a steady rhythm with your taps. Avoid over-tapping, which can cause your character to hit the top wall. Practice regularly to get a feel for the timing of the gaps. Stay calm and patient, as frustration can lead to mistakes. Watch your character's trajectory and adjust your taps accordingly. With persistence, you will see your scores improve over time.
